Patient Access Representative
We are looking for a Patient Access Representative to be the first point of contact for patients and assist them in obtaining medical care. The Patient Access Representative's responsibilities include collecting patient details, preparing admission documentation, explaining policies and procedures, and handling patient queries, concerns, and complaints. To be successful as a Patient Access Representative you should be able to perform administrative tasks with high efficiency and always maintain a positive and professional demeanor. Ultimately, a top Patient Access Representative is compassionate and committed to helping people.

Patient Access Representative Responsibilities:
- Greeting patients and their caregivers on arrival.
- Collecting information such as patient details and insurance information.
- Preparing patient admission documentation.
- Entering information into databases and maintaining accurate records.
- Relayed information to relevant staff members.
- Providing patients with insurance and payment information.
- Dealing with patient questions, concerns, and issues.
- Performing general administrative tasks.
